#加载数据集
def loadDataSet(fileName):
dataMat=[]
fltLine=[]
fr = open(fileName)
#跳过第一行的循环
for line in islice(fr, 1, None):
#将字符串转换为列表
line = line.replace("," , ";")
curLine=line.strip().split(';' )
#将每一行的数据映射成float型
#!!!py3.x中map()返回的是迭代器,需转化为列表
fltLine=list((map(float,curLine)))
dataMat.append(fltLine)
return dataMat
数据集cvs载入处理代码块
最新推荐文章于 2022-05-24 00:26:11 发布